Harrdy Sandhu played the role of Madan Lal

Harrdy Sandhu has been in the news recently for his famous song Bijlee Bijlee which has gone viral on social media. However, not many know that the singer has also played cricket for India U-19 team which is why he also bagged a role as an actor in 83. In the film, he has played the role of Madan Lal, who had notably coached Sandhu at National Cricket Academy camp during his playing days.

"I am a singer by profession, cricketer by passion, and an actor by chance," Sandhu had described himself in a post on social media. Without a doubt, Madan Lal was an integral member of India's side which created history 38 years back and Sandhu has certainly done complete justice to the role of his mentor.

Sandeep Patil's son enacted his father

Everyone in their lives want to make their parents proud. But very rarely, someone gets an opportunity to do it by playing their character on the big screen! Well something very similar happened in the movie 83 when Chirag Patil enacted the role of his father Sandeep Patil.

Reflecting on the role, Chirag had stated on social media, "As a boy, I idolised him; Now, I aspire to be a man like him. How fortunate must I be to portray my superhero on screen? The man who took India to the finals. Presenting Mumbai ka Sandstorm, Sandeep Patil." As expected, the son has recreated the magic of his father's heroics with some perfection!

Balwinder Singh Sandhu coached entire crew

Considering the fact that all the actors of 83 needed some professional training as they were playing the roles of some legendary cricketers, movie director Kabir Khan put that responsibility on the shoulders of Balwinder Singh Sandhu. And the 65-year-old has done a phenomenal job which can be seen with the performances of the actors on the big screen.

“I treat all the actors like actual cricketers and follow the same techniques that I do at the National Cricket Academy, " Sandhu had said during the shooting of the movie. From training the cast at Dharamshala in a camp to being with them during the filming in UK, Sandhu is one of the key reasons behind the perfection of 83.

Reflecting on his role as an associate director in the movie, Sandhu said, "Kapdo me kitna mitti hona chahiye, yeh bhi maine decide kiya tha. Mujhe bohot creative satisfaction mila," (The extent of mud stains on the clothing was also decided by me. It gave me a lot of creative satisfaction)
